The glass sea creatures (alternately called the Blaschka sea creatures, glass marine invertebrates, Blaschka invertebrate models, and Blaschka glass invertebrates) are works of glass artists Leopold and Rudolf Blaschka. The artistic predecessors of the Glass Flowers, the sea creatures were the output of the Blaschkas' successful mail-order business of supplying museums and private collectors around the world with sets of glass models of marine invertebrates. Between 1863 and 1880, the Blaschkas – working in Dresden – executed at least 10,000 of these highly detailed glass models, representing some 700 different species. A number of large collections of the models are held by museums and other academic institutions. Harvard's Museum of Natural History exhibits many of the Blaschka's glass creations, and its Museum of Comparative Zoology hold 430 items in the Blaschka Glass Invertebrate Collection and display about 60 at any given time. Cornell University has about 570 items in its collection and has restored some 170 of these, with many others in its collection stored at the Corning Museum of Glass in Corning, New York. The largest collection in Europe, of 530 pieces, is at Ireland's Natural History Museum. Other holdings include the Boston Museum of Science; the Field Museum of Natural History in Chicago, Natural History Museum in London, Redpath Museum of McGill University in Montreal, Natural History Museum in Geneva, and both Trinity College Dublin and University College Dublin in Ireland; Hancock Museum in Newcastle upon Tyne, England; University Museum in Utrecht, The Grant Museum of Zoology in London, and Aquarium-Museum in Liège, Belgium, the Canterbury Museum, Christchurch in New Zealand and Melbourne Museum, in Melbourne, Australia.
Inspiration
In 1853, shortly after the death of his father and wife Caroline, the latter to a cholera epidemic, Leopold Blaschka – grief stricken and in need of a vacation – traveled to the United States. En route the ship was becalmed and lay still upon the sea for two weeks. During this period of forced idleness, Leopold studied and sketched the local marine invertebrate population, intrigued by the transparency of their bodies similar to the glass his family had long worked. Leopold felt a sense of quiet, inspirational, wonder at these luminescent ocean dwellers, a sense which he recorded and translated by Henri Reiling: "It is a beautiful night in May. Hopeful, we look out over the darkness of the sea, which is as smooth as a mirror; there emerges all around in various places a flashlike bundle of light beams, as if it is surrounded by thousands of sparks, that form true bundles of fire and of other bright lighting spots, and the seemingly mirrored stars. There emerges close before us a small spot in a sharp greenish light, which becomes ever larger and larger and finally becomes a bright shining sunlike figure." This sense of wonder would fuel his later work but, in the meantime and upon his return to Dresden, Leopold focused on his family business which was the production of the glass eyes, costume ornaments, lab equipment, and other such fancy goods and specialty items; plus the task of training of his son and apprentice (who was his eventual successor), Rudolf Blaschka.
Reichenbach's request
Director of the natural history museum in Dresden, Prof. Reichenbach was faced with an annoying yet seemingly unsolvable problem in regards to showing marine life. Land-based flora and fauna was not an issue, for it was a relatively simple matter to exhibit mounted and stuffed creatures such as gorillas and elephants, their lifelike poses attracting and exciting the museum's visitors. Invertebrates, however, by their very nature, posed a problem. In the 19th century the only practiced method of showcasing them was to take a live specimen and place it in a sealed jar of alcohol. This of course killed it but, more importantly, time and their lack of hard parts eventually rendered them into little more than colorless floating blobs of jelly. Neither pretty nor a terribly effective teaching tool, Prof. Reichenbach wanted something more, specifically 3D colored models of marine invertebrates that were both lifelike and able to stand the test of time. By coincidence, in 1863, he "saw an exhibition of highly detailed, realistic glass flowers created by a Bohemian lampworker named Leopold Blaschka."
Enchanted by the botanical models, and positive that Leopold held the key to ending his own showcasing issue, in 1863 Reichenbach convinced and commissioned Leopold to produce twelve model sea anemones. These marine models, hailed as "an artistic marvel in the field of science and a scientific marvel in the field of art", were a great improvement on previous methods of presenting such creatures: drawings, pressing, photographs and papier-mâché or wax models. and exactly what Prof. Reichenbach needed. Moreover they, at last, provided an outlet for the wonder Leopold had felt all those years ago when observing the phosphorescent ocean life. The key fact, though, was that these glass marine models were, as would soon be acknowledged, "perfectly true to nature", and as such represented an opportunity both for the scientific community and the Blaschkas themselves (to create sea anemone images faithful to nature, images from P.H. Gosse's Actinologia Britannica, 1860, were utilised). Knowing this, and thrilled with his newly acquired set of glass sea creatures, Reichenbach advised Leopold to drop his current and generations long family business of glass fancy goods and the like in favor of selling glass marine invertebrates to museums, aquaria, universities, and private collectors. Advice which would prove wise and fateful both economically and scientifically, for Leopold did as the Dresden natural history museum director suggested.
